Llandybie portrait artist Andy Wardrop currently has a solo show in Carmarthen.
Andy recently graduated from Carmarthen School of Art with a B.A. (Hons) in Fine Art and his portraiture work is being exhibited until October 6 at the Bean Jones Gallery, King Street with his subjects being his family and friends.
His unique style is obtained by using acrylic paint on canvas with a 'dry brush' technique.
Painting from his studio at his home in Llandeilo Road, Andy also specialises in abstract work which appear to be a kaleidoscope of shapes and patterns inspired by his local rural surroundings.
Andy is an active member of Amman Valley Art Group and regularly takes part in the annual Tywi Valley Open Studios.
